Author:  DéjàVoodoo [ Mar 21st, '11, 09:28 ]
Post subject:  Re: Best glue/sealant for use with IBCs?

silicon can actually be tricky. Without air it will not cure, so "loads" of it in an environment like inside a pipe does not work all that well. The outside of it will cure, but that protects the silicon under it from curing. So if you use lots of silicon, make sure you put it on in layers and allow to dry between each.

Author:  netab32 [ Mar 22nd, '11, 06:48 ]
Post subject:  Re: Best glue/sealant for use with IBCs?

Thanks for the plug Jorgy :thumbleft: .....(will slip ya the 5 bucks next time im in Mackay :wink: )

We used silicone initially but then switched to Sikaflex for a lot of it - think its FE11. Spent a bit of time on their website sifting through the HUNDREDS of products they make and found this was the best one for our needs. Works really well... plus if your patient, you can actually repair tiny leaks underwater which is helpful.

We capped all our taps this way and only had one that leaked a bit... so just stuck another disk to the outside of the tap outlet - worked perfectly.

Might be worth not cutting it off as the ball valve will still help hold back the water pressure... then you can think of the disks as stopping the leaks - not having to hold all the water back themselves... although they would probably be able to do it, the more help youve got the better... just IMO... good luck :D

Author:  Outbackozzie [ Mar 22nd, '11, 20:55 ]
Post subject:  Re: Best glue/sealant for use with IBCs?

I had heaps of trouble with one IBC that I just could not seal the tap on it.

I ended up using heaps of normal silicone, fortified with Kalgoorlie clay :D

The clay held the silicone together, and cured a plug of about 50mm long into the tap outlet. (I went through 3 tubes of silicone trying to seal it before adding the clay )

6 months later.....Still leak free....

But yeah, normal silicone will not seal a large hole by itself, it just collapses.
